Big Brother 17: Did Late Night Talks Shift Clay Eviction Plans?

Much later on in the night, practically the morning, James tells Becky (FB 5:40AM BBT) that they have only 3 solid votes to evict Shelli: Jackie, Meg, and Becky. It’s a good sign for James and company if they know this isn’t sown up like they previously thought. I’m more interested in know if Clay has any inkling he’s this close to going home.

Clay wasn’t campaigning to Austin in that talk and according to Vanessa’s earlier talk with Shelli it sounded more like Clay was confident he was staying. I don’t think Clay has even gone back to JMac who is following his marching orders to evict Clay per his original request.

Can Clay be saved? Yes and here’s one way it could happen. Take those 3 votes and you’ll need just 2 more. If Clay talks to Johnny Mac then I’m fairly sure he’ll change his vote to keep Clay. Now we’re at 4. Who else wants to keep Clay? Austin. That’s 5. BUT Austin is afraid to turn on Vanessa so how does he handle that? Pin it on Steve.

Steve is sticking with Vanessa and will vote the way she wants, but Austin could flip his vote then blame Steve saying he was the one to throw the hinky vote. This could be a tough sell but a way to make it easier is to have the twins still vote out Clay. Then you’ve got Vanessa + twins + 1 extra vote against Clay and Austin could sidestep in to that vote saying he voted the same as the twins.

It’s an interesting situation and I like this a lot more than a rollover move by Clay where he just flops and dies in the name of a showmance. Sending Shelli home is a better move for everyone but Vanessa and I’m surprised more people don’t see that, but it’s a testament to how well Vanessa is manipulating her allies.
